IT was a nail-biting end to the season for Shipton-under-Wychwood, who needed the Duckworth-Lewis method to beat Gerrards Cross by one run in Division 2 of the Serious Cricket Home Counties Premier League.

Visitors Shipton chose to bat and were dismissed for 174, with Joe Barrett hitting 62 as he dominated a 106-run second-wicket stand with Anupam Sanklecha.

The match was heading for a close finale with the hosts on 119-6 in the 25th over, before the rain arrived and the west Oxon side earned the spoils – by a whisker.
